Essential Duties & Responsibilities

The Operations Supervisor supervises, coordinates and monitors administrative and financial records for the assigned Department. Directly supervises medical assistants and is the administrative liaison for the assigned department(s).

  • Ensures that the assigned department(s) runs smoothly, efficiently and professionally on a daily basis.
  • Assists with new hire orientation, training, supervising, and assigning tasks to assigned staff.
  • Manages work flow and monitors quality of work of the assigned group to ensure an efficient operational flow, timely completion of assignments and adherence to department’s standards and regulations.
  • Coordinates and maintains the monthly schedule for the assigned department(s). Tracks and collects employees’ hours; reviews employee hours against the scheduled time to work, tracks leaves and vacation/sick time for the Department. Submits weekly timesheets to the manager/director, and in the absence of manager/director, submits timesheets to Payroll Department.
  • Monitors performance of medical assistants and compliance with departmental procedures and completes annual performance appraisals.
  • Serves as first point of contact for benefit and payroll questions for all department employees.
  • Works with managers and staff to resolve employee relations issues, drawing on appropriate BMC resources.
  • Maintains and coordinates manager’s calendar. Schedules meetings, coordinates audio-visual and technology requirements, orders catering services, etc., as needed.
  • Analyzes, categorizes and prioritizes correspondence; responds to communications on behalf of the Clinic Director; acts with a high level of independence in determining appropriate course of action.
  • Collaborates with the department’s educators in creating an orientation schedule for all new staff. Schedules all mandatory trainings for staff.
  • Maintains and supervises the maintenance of departmental files, manuals and records.
  • Provides backup support for other administrative staff during breaks and time out of the office.
  • Assists with project management and follow-through.
  • Participates in quality improvement teams as required.
  • Deals discreetly with confidential information concerning professional and patient issues including correspondence, test results, billing data, etc.
  • Creates reports, spreadsheets, presentations and other correspondence requested.
